资讯专栏INFORMATION COLUMN

#anujs#anujs+webpack4+reach-router环境搭建过程中遇到的BUG

zhonghanwen / 1676人阅读

摘要:对象不支持属性或方法在中老版本的的是没有方法的,并且对象也没有方法。

对象不支持“hasOwnProperty”属性或方法 在IE8中

老版本的 IE 的 DOM Element 是没有 hasOwnProperty 方法的,
并且window 对象也没有 hasOwnProperty 方法。
我们可以使用 Object 对象的 hasOwnProperty 。

Object.prototype.hasOwnProperty.call(window, "property")
Object.prototype.hasOwnProperty.call(element, "property")
SCRIPT5009: “Promise”未定义 在IE8中
"use strict";

    (function () {
        if (typeof Object.assign != "function") {
            (function () {
                Object.assign = function (target) {
                    "use strict";
                    if (target === undefined || target === null) {
                        throw new TypeError("Cannot convert undefined or null to object");
                    }

                    var output = Object(target);
                    for (var index = 1; index < arguments.length; index++) {
                        var source = arguments[index];
                        if (source !== undefined && source !== null) {
                            for (var nextKey in source) {
                                if (Object.prototype.hasOwnProperty.call(source, nextKey)) {
                                    output[nextKey] = source[nextKey];
                                }
                            }
                        }
                    }
                    return output;
                };
            })();
        }
    })();

文章版权归作者所有,未经允许请勿转载,若此文章存在违规行为,您可以联系管理员删除。

转载请注明本文地址:https://www.ucloud.cn/yun/104202.html

相关文章

  • 高性能迷你React框架 anu1.3.0 发布

    摘要:是一款高性能框架,是目前世界上对兼容最好的迷你库。自起,相继推出,与等新,表明官方正积极由纯库向大而全的框架演变,它将会越来越好用。一些迷你库可能跟不上步伐,现在也只有有这实力跟进。 anujs1.3.0是一款高性能React-like框架,是目前世界上对React16兼容最好的迷你库。 自React16起,相继推出createContext,createPortal, createR...

    Flands 评论0 收藏0
  • 高性能迷你React框架 anu1.2.1 发布

    摘要:这次更新主要是改善了对焦点的处理及的语法糖的支持优化的性能,将原方法内部用到函数与对象提到全局上来,这就比官方的对象池技术更能提升性能。 anu1.2.1这次更新主要是改善了对焦点的处理及react16.2的Fragment语法糖的支持 优化fiberizeChildren的性能,将原方法内部用到函数与对象提到全局上来,这就比官方的对象池技术更能提升性能。 修复受控组件在textar...

    phpmatt 评论0 收藏0
  • 高性能迷你React框架anujs1.1.3发布

    摘要:现在只差一个组件就完全支持阿里的库了。一共跑通个测试应该是全世界最接近官方的迷你框架了。以后的工作就是把的一些新特性支持了,包括组件返回数字字符串数组,钩子与。随着代码的增加,我会将一些废弃的方法拆分出来。在打包时,根据你们的喜好进行选择。 anujs现在只差一个组件(mention)就完全支持阿里的antd UI库了。一共跑通346个测试, 应该是全世界最接近官方React的迷你框架...

    hosition 评论0 收藏0
  • 高性能迷你React框架 anu1.2.3 发布

    摘要:本版本主要添加了的支持解决的问题修复的模块的的支持添加方法,增强对第三方的支持使用或者使用架手架中如何代替原来用编写的项目若要兼容请使用以下配置如果引用了或需要添加如下别名如果你在移动端用到了事件欢迎大家为加星星与试用 本版本主要添加了renderToNodeStream的支持 解决PropTypes的share问题 var check = function () { ...

    JasinYip 评论0 收藏0
  • 高性能迷你React框架 anu1.2 发布,支持React16三大特性

    摘要:支持的三大特征,组件支持返回数组,传送门与错误边界。下面是新支持的特性的第一个参数可以是数组,字符串,数字,。有了它,成为对错误处理最完善的框架。虚拟的结构发生变化,每个节点都有等描述自己位置的属性。 anu已经有两个月没有发布了,经过1.1.5-pre, 1.1.5-pre2, 1.1.5-pre3, 1.1.5-pre4, 1.1.5-pre5, 1.1.5-pre6, 最终放弃了...

    whidy 评论0 收藏0

发表评论

0条评论

最新活动
阅读需要支付1元查看
<